NYPD seeking suspext who broke burglarized Queens church

NEW YORK CITY, NY – The New York City Police Department is investigating a burglary that occurred at a house of worship located at 25-02 80 Street in Queens.

The suspect broke into and robbed the Our Lady of Fatima Roman Catholic Church.

On Thursday, May 18, at approximately 5:30 am, an unknown individual broke into the location and stole approximately $60 in cash, along with various religious items valued at $890.

Police are seeking the public’s help to identify the burglar. Any information should be forwarded to NYPD’s Crime Stoppers Hotline.
